Calculate the distance between two points (-6,8) and (-8,3) ?

Answer:

d = √29

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the distance formula d = √(x2 - x1)² + (y2 - y1)²

d = √(x2 - x1)² + (y2 - y1)²

d = √(-8 - -6)² + (3 - 8)²

d = √(-2)² + (5)²

d = √4 + 25

d = √29
